Booking and Pricing Details
Pricing for the Miami Half Day Deep Sea Fishing Trip starts from $75.00 per person.
This fee includes rods, reels, tackle, and a fishing license. For a small additional charge, the crew will clean any fish caught during the trip.
The experience offers free cancellation up to 24 hours in advance, and confirmation is provided within 48 hours, subject to availability.
The trip can accommodate up to 40 travelers, making it suitable for groups.
Meeting Point and Location
The meeting point for the Miami Half Day Deep Sea Fishing Trip is Bayside Marketplace, located at 401 Biscayne Blvd in Miami, Florida.
Participants will find the boat docked at Pier 5, on the north end of the Bayside Marina. The activity ends back at the same meeting point.
While the location is accessible via public transportation, the trip isn’t wheelchair accessible. Travelers should plan their transportation accordingly, as the experience begins and concludes at the Bayside Marketplace meeting point.

Customer Feedback and Experiences
How do customers rate their overall experience on the Miami half-day deep-sea fishing trip? The activity has 180 reviews with an average rating of 3.5 stars.
Customers praise the crew’s friendliness and helpfulness, but have mixed experiences regarding fishing success and sea sickness. Some also complain about customer service and communication issues.
However, the crew is noted for their attentiveness to families and children. While the fishing trips may be affected by weather, some travelers report dissatisfaction with the overall experience, particularly related to crew interaction and fishing success.
Potential Seasickness and Weather Considerations
Participants should be aware of potential sea sickness, as the fishing trips take place in the open waters of the Atlantic Ocean. The boat’s movement can cause motion sickness for some individuals.
It’s recommended to bring motion sickness medication or wearable motion sickness devices to mitigate the effects.
Plus, weather conditions can impact the fishing trips. Strong winds, heavy rain, or rough seas may force the cancellation or rescheduling of the tour.
The tour operator closely monitors the weather and will make decisions accordingly to ensure the safety and enjoyment of participants.
Proper planning and preparation can help minimize weather-related disruptions.
